This study was motivated by the low learning outcomes of students, their lack of focus during lessons, and their limited enthusiasm for learning. Therefore, the aim of this research was to determine the effect of picture card media on the science learning outcomes of fifth-grade students at SD YPK Yeflio, Sorong Regency. The research employed a quantitative pre-experimental method with a one-group pretest–posttest design. The sample consisted of 20 students. Data collection technique by distributing a multiple choice test instrument consisting of 20 questions, and the results were analyzed using normality testing and statistical analysis (t-test). The pretest results showed an average score of 60.25, while the posttest results showed an increased average score of 74.75. The t-test results indicated that the calculated t-value was higher than the critical t-value (11.854 1.72913) and the Sig. (2-tailed) value of 0.000 was less than 0.05, leading to the rejection of H0 and acceptance of Ha. Thus, it can be concluded that picture card media has a significant effect on the science learning outcomes of fifth-grade students at SD YPK Yeflio, Sorong Regency.
